Add 60/4 and 90/9
1st number: 15 0/4, 2nd number: 10 0/9
60/4 + 90/9 is 25/1.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 4 and 9 is 36
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 36 - For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 9 = 36,
60/4 = 60 × 9/4 × 9 = 540/36 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 9 × 4 = 36,
90/9 = 90 × 4/9 × 4 = 360/36 - Add the two like fractions:
540/36 + 360/36 = 540 + 360/36 = 900/36 - 900/36 simplified gives 25/1
- So, 60/4 + 90/9 = 25/1
